Numerical study of the Davey-Stewartson system

Christophe Besse, Norbert J. Mauser, Hans Peter Stimming (2004)

ESAIM: Mathematical Modelling and Numerical Analysis - Modélisation Mathématique et Analyse Numérique

We deal with numerical analysis and simulations of the Davey-Stewartson equations which model, for example, the evolution of water surface waves. This time dependent PDE system is particularly interesting as a generalization of the 1-d integrable NLS to 2 space dimensions. We use a time splitting spectral method where we give a convergence analysis for the semi-discrete version of the scheme.
